About the Role & Team

The Content Security team is a part of the Studio Technology organization inside The Walt Disney Studios.

We are looking for a proactive and very organized Executive Assistant to support the Vice President, Content Security. The successful candidate is someone who can step into and navigate a complex and high-paced environment of hardworking, friendly, and passionate people. You are bright, detail-oriented, a problem solver, cheerful, and confident. You are invigorated by problem solving and have a “can do” attitude. You are also looking to deepen your knowledge within the technology and entertainment industry and have a passion for the movie business.

What You Will Do

Manage day to day schedule of the VP, Content Security including responding to meeting requests, negotiating and gatekeeping time, while proactively scheduling key stakeholder engagements and maintaining confidentiality

Perform the role of a proactive partner and collaborator to the VP, staying ‘one step ahead’

Create and manage presentations, reports, agendas, and other documentation as needed

Assist, track, and manage special projects

Find innovative solutions to improve team coordination, hold team members accountable, and drive efficiency throughout the organization

Support preparation of monthly and quarterly reports entailing heavy word processing and strong organizational skills

Act as a team culture liaison between Content Security and Studio Technology

Ability to immerse into the team to be a true partner for Content Security as a key resource, partner in initiatives, and team morale

Communication and Correspondence: Interface seamlessly with various Disney departments, executives, business units, and external organizations

Perform research and provide reports on highly visible programs and projects

Schedule, organize, and prepare for meetings, including gathering necessary documentation

Coordinate and schedule travel and manage expense reports

Assist in scheduling and managing logistics for team events and activities

Coordinate onboarding for new hires and ensure a smooth experience

Post, update, and maintain documents to SharePoint and other collaboration sites

Build and maintain good relationships with partners and trusted vendors

Support the team with ad-hoc requests including order office equipment, snacks, and any administrative supplies

Required Qualifications & Skills

Minimum 3 years administrative experience supporting senior level executives in a corporate environment

Excellent communication and time management skills with the ability to shift from project to project without missing a step

Excellent written, verbal, and interpersonal communication skills to assure successful interaction with all levels of employees and external contacts

Proficient at managing and prioritizing information and meetings for executives

Handle high profile and sensitive information with confidentiality and discretion

Ability to work and build relationships with Disney employees at all levels
